Who is Taco Bell?

Taco Bell was born and raised in California and has been around since 1962. We went from selling everyone’s favorite Crunchy Tacos on the West Coast to a global brand with 8,200+ restaurants, 350 franchise organizations, that serve 42+ million fans each week around the globe. We’re not only the largest Mexican-inspired quick service brand (QSR) in the world, we’re also part of the biggest restaurant group in the world: Yum! Brands

About the Job:

The Creative Director, Global Brand Creative, is responsible for driving a cohesive vision for the future of Taco Bell both domestically and globally. Their passion for creative thinking goes beyond any one medium or genre and they have their pulse on current industry trends. They are an experienced people leader who will coach, inspire and mentor teams to direct work that is leading in culture and impactful to the business.

By creating opportunities for individual development, performance management and recognition, they foster a culture of collaboration, innovation, and fun. They are responsible for growing a scalable creative department that will execute the creative vision for global brand storytelling across digital, experiential, print, and video mediums. They have a proven track record of success in fast-paced environments, demonstrating the ability to prioritize and manage multiple projects simultaneously while keeping their team aligned with key priorities.

The Day-to-Day:

  • Provide creative direction, design and conceptual solutions that result in cohesive messaging and branding that are industry-leading and on brief
  • Develop concepts for campaign launches and product storytelling
  • Develop and lead a team of best-in-class creatives that can execute against the brand strategy, strategically leveraging the strengths of individuals and supplementing with creative partner skill sets
  • Lead multiple creative teams, including reviewing, providing meaningful feedback and approving storytelling, design, motion and photo art direction
  • Oversee and nurture creative and cross-functional team relationships, enabling a healthy and collaborative environment
  • Partner with creative operations to drive and evolve a creative process that is scalable to future growth while ensuring execution against creative briefs, creative review process, and deadlines
  • Drive the mindset of a unified Global Brand Creative team by seeking out and enabling opportunities to share and learn across the team
  • Enable world class creative by strategically leveraging team talent and strengths alongside creative partnerships with external talent
  • Elevate potential roadblocks to VP while proactively providing creative recommendations to solve problems
  • Stay up-to-date with design trends, design tools and industry best practices
  • Reports directly to the VP, Global Brand Creative

Is This You?

  • 12+ years of design and creative direction experience
  • 7+ years of leadership experience
  • BA or BFA Degree in a related field or equivalent experience
  • Strategic thinker with the ability to articulate creative concepts & vision
  • Strong business acumen with the understanding of delivering against multi-billion dollar company brand goals
  • Deep understanding of design principles, visual storytelling, and a keen eye for aesthetic
  • Superior storyteller, ability to sell ideas via strong presentation skills
  • Proficiency in design software, including Adobe Creative Suite, Figma and Keynote
